阿里开源MySQL监听工具:高效监控数据库新选择

阿里开源mysql监听

时间:2025-06-14 10:46


阿里开源MySQL监听:数据库监控与管理的新篇章 在当今的大数据时代,数据库作为信息系统的核心组件,其性能和稳定性直接关系到业务的连续性和用户体验

    MySQL,作为开源数据库领域的佼佼者,凭借其灵活性、高性能和广泛的社区支持,成为了众多企业的首选

    然而,随着业务规模的扩张和数据量的激增,MySQL数据库的监控与管理变得日益复杂

    正是在这样的背景下,阿里巴巴开源了其MySQL监听工具,为数据库管理员和开发者提供了一套强大的监控与管理解决方案

     一、背景与需求 随着云计算、大数据、人工智能等技术的蓬勃发展,企业对数据处理能力的需求与日俱增

    MySQL数据库作为数据存储和检索的关键一环,其运行状态、性能瓶颈、故障预警等问题成为了企业关注的重点

    传统的数据库监控手段往往依赖于日志分析、手动巡检等方式,不仅效率低下,而且难以全面覆盖所有潜在问题

    因此,一种能够实时、智能、全面地监控MySQL数据库运行状态的工具显得尤为重要

     阿里巴巴,作为全球领先的电子商务和科技公司,其业务规模庞大,对数据库的性能和稳定性有着极高的要求

    在长期的技术实践中,阿里巴巴积累了丰富的数据库监控与管理经验,并开发出了一套高效、可靠的MySQL监听工具

    为了推动数据库监控技术的发展,阿里巴巴决定将这一工具开源,让更多的企业和开发者受益

     二、阿里开源MySQL监听的核心价值 1.实时监控与预警 阿里开源的MySQL监听工具能够实时监控数据库的各项性能指标,包括但不限于CPU使用率、内存占用、磁盘I/O、网络带宽、查询响应时间等

    通过设定阈值和触发条件,一旦数据库性能出现异常波动或达到预警值,工具将立即发送警报通知相关人员,确保问题能够得到及时处理

     2.智能诊断与优化 该工具不仅具备实时监控功能,还能够对数据库进行智能诊断

    通过分析数据库的慢查询日志、锁等待情况、索引使用情况等信息,工具能够自动识别出性能瓶颈和潜在问题,并提供针对性的优化建议

    这大大降低了数据库优化的难度和成本,提升了系统的整体性能

     3.全面可视化展示 阿里开源的MySQL监听工具提供了丰富的可视化展示功能

    通过直观的图表和仪表盘,用户可以清晰地看到数据库的各项性能指标变化趋势、历史数据对比等信息

    这不仅有助于用户快速了解数据库的运行状态,还能够为决策提供有力的数据支持

     4.灵活扩展与集成 为了满足不同企业和开发者的需求,该工具提供了灵活的扩展接口和集成方案

    用户可以根据自己的业务需求定制监控指标、报警规则等;同时,工具也支持与其他监控系统(如Prometheus、Grafana等)进行集成,实现更加全面、统一的监控管理

     三、技术亮点与实现原理 1.高性能数据采集 阿里开源的MySQL监听工具采用了高效的数据采集技术,能够实时、准确地获取数据库的各项性能指标

    通过优化数据采集算法和减少不必要的资源消耗,工具在确保监控精度的同时,也降低了对数据库性能的影响

     2.智能分析引擎 工具内置了智能分析引擎,能够对采集到的数据进行深度挖掘和分析

    通过运用机器学习、数据挖掘等技术手段,引擎能够自动识别出数据库中的异常行为和潜在风险,为用户提供精准的诊断结果和优化建议

     3.可视化技术栈 为了实现全面的可视化展示功能,工具采用了先进的前端技术和图表库

    通过精心设计的用户界面和交互逻辑,用户能够轻松上手并快速获取所需信息

    同时,工具还支持多种数据导出格式和自定义报表功能,满足用户多样化的需求

     4.分布式架构设计 为了适应大规模数据库集群的监控需求,工具采用了分布式架构设计

    通过水平扩展和负载均衡等技术手段,工具能够高效地处理海量监控数据并确保系统的稳定性和可靠性

     四、应用场景与实践案例 1.电商平台数据库监控 对于电商平台而言,数据库的稳定性和性能直接关系到用户体验和业务连续性

    通过采用阿里开源的MySQL监听工具,电商平台能够实时监控数据库的运行状态并及时发现潜在问题

    例如,在某次大促活动中,工具成功预警了一起因并发量激增导致的数据库性能下降事件,运维人员迅速采取措施进行扩容和优化,确保了活动的顺利进行

     2.金融系统数据库安全监控 金融系统对数据库的安全性和稳定性有着极高的要求

    通过集成阿里开源的MySQL监听工具,金融企业能够实现对数据库访问行为的实时监控和异常检测

    例如,在某次黑客攻击事件中,工具及时发现了异常登录行为和SQL注入攻击尝试,并触发了报警机制

    安全团队迅速响应并采取措施进行防御和溯源,有效避免了潜在的安全风险

     3.大数据分析平台数据仓库监控 大数据分析平台通常需要对海量数据进行存储和分析,对数据库的性能和可扩展性提出了极高的要求

    通过采用阿里开源的MySQL监听工具,大数据分析平台能够实时监控数据仓库的运行状态并进行性能调优

    例如,在某次数据导入任务中,工具发现了数据倾斜导致的性能瓶颈问题,并提供了分区优化和索引调整等建议

    经过优化后,数据导入任务的性能得到了显著提升

     五、未来展望与挑战 随着技术的不断进步和业务需求的不断变化,阿里开源的MySQL监听工具也将面临新的挑战和发展机遇

    未来,我们将继续优化工具的性能和功能,提升用户体验和满意度;同时,我们也将积极探索与新技术(如容器化、云原生等)的融合应用,为数据库监控与管理领域注入新的活力

     然而,我们也清醒地认识到,开源项目的成功离不开社区的广泛参与和支持

    因此,我们将积极构建和维护一个开放、包容、协作的社区环境,鼓励更多的开发者参与到工具的开发和维护中来

    通过共同努力,我们相信阿里开源的MySQL监听工具将成为数据库监控与管理领域的一面旗帜,引领技术的不断创新和发展

     结语 阿里开源MySQL监听工具的问世,无疑为数据库管理员和开发者提供了一套强大的监控与管理解决方案

    通过实时监控、智能诊断、全面可视化展示等功能,工具不仅降低了数据库管理的难度和成本,还提升了系统的整体性能和稳定性

    未来,我们将继续致力于技术的创新和优化,为数据库监控与管理领域贡献更多的智慧和力量

    让我们携手共进,共同迎接大数据时代的挑战与机遇!